The construction of the Claddagh Basin

Thu, Jul 21, 2022

On January 1, 1848, Samuel U Roberts was appointed district engineer of the Districts of Lough Corrib. He spent the early part of that year making necessary preparations and arrangements and started navigational works in Galway on March 8, having taken possession of some of the lands required for the Eglinton Canal.

The woman at the door of Tyrone House

Thu, Jul 21, 2022

On the afternoon of March 18 1912, Violet Martin and her friend Tilly Redington, arrived at the door of Tyrone House, the home of the less than ordinary St George family. The three storey house, in the luxurious Palladian style, and said to be sumptuously decorated inside, is dramatically located by the estuary of the Kilcolgan river, about 2 miles distant from Kilcolgan village.

Violet was related to the Martins of Ballynahinch. Her father boasted that like his cousin Humanity Dick he had not lost one of his tenants during the Great Famine. The cost of such generosity was bankruptcy which both families bore as bravely as they could. On this March afternoon Violet was an established author. She and her cousin Edith Somerville of Castletownshend, West Cork, had effectively cooperated in a series of books on the landlord class. They had just published what would be their most successful novel: ‘Some Reminiscences of an Irish RM’.*

The class of ‘82

Thu, Jul 14, 2022

One hundred and sixty years ago, in 1862, the Jesuits opened the doors of St Ignatius' College on Sea Road for the first time. They also opened a community residence and a church at the same time. To take on such an ambitious building project at a time when the economic state of the country was so bad took courage and vision.

Long Covid – help is at hand

Thu, Jul 14, 2022

Most people who get Covid-19 get better very quickly. Some people continue to experience symptoms, and even have other symptoms develop in the weeks and sometimes months following their infection. This is commonly referred to as long Covid. Some of the more common long Covid symptoms include a lasting cough, fatigue, aches and pains, brain fog, loss of taste, loss of sense of smell, and insomnia.

Current treatments for long Covid currently focus on managing the symptoms and improving quality of life. One recommended treatment for long Covid is hyperbaric oxygenation. Users of hyperbaric oxygenation are reporting relief for a wide range of long Covid symptoms. They are reporting better quality sleep, more energy, relief from pain, improved sense of smell and/or taste, and improved concentration after a series of sessions. Hyperbaric oxygenation is proven to help reduce inflammation, encourage new blood vessel growth, and stem cell production.

Traversing the Banana Pancake Trail

Thu, Jul 14, 2022

BY AISLING COWLEY
After months of researching potential destinations and planning my trip to Southeast Asia, I came across the ‘Banana Pancake Trail’. The banana pancake trail received its name from the inexpensive banana pancakes that are served at street markets throughout Southeast Asia and are so popular with backpackers in particular.
